#ifdef HAVE_CONFIG_H
# include <config.h>
#endif
#include "libguile/_scm.h"
#include "libguile/goops.h"
#include "libguile/foreign-object.h"
static SCM make_fobj_type_var;
static void
init_make_fobj_type_var (void)
{
make_fobj_type_var = scm_c_private_lookup ("system foreign-object",
"make-foreign-object-type");
}
SCM
scm_make_foreign_object_type (SCM name, SCM slot_names,
scm_t_struct_finalize finalizer)
{
SCM type;
static scm_i_pthread_once_t once = SCM_I_PTHREAD_ONCE_INIT;
scm_i_pthread_once (&once, init_make_fobj_type_var);
type = scm_call_2 (scm_variable_ref (make_fobj_type_var), name, slot_names);
if (finalizer)
SCM_SET_VTABLE_INSTANCE_FINALIZER (type, finalizer);
return type;
}
void
scm_assert_foreign_object_type (SCM type, SCM val)
{
if (!SCM_IS_A_P (val, type))
scm_error (scm_arg_type_key, NULL, "Wrong type (expecting ~A): ~S",
scm_list_2 (scm_class_name (type), val), scm_list_1 (val));
}
SCM
scm_make_foreign_object_1 (SCM type, scm_t_bits val0)
{
return scm_make_foreign_object_n (type, 1, &val0);
}
SCM
scm_make_foreign_object_2 (SCM type, scm_t_bits val0, scm_t_bits val1)
{
scm_t_bits vals[2] = { val0, val1 };
return scm_make_foreign_object_n (type, 2, vals);
}
SCM
scm_make_foreign_object_3 (SCM type, scm_t_bits val0, scm_t_bits val1,
scm_t_bits val2)
{
scm_t_bits vals[3] = { val0, val1, val2 };
return scm_make_foreign_object_n (type, 3, vals);
}
SCM
scm_make_foreign_object_n (SCM type, size_t n, scm_t_bits vals[])
#define FUNC_NAME "make-foreign-object"
{
SCM obj;
SCM layout;
size_t i;
SCM_VALIDATE_VTABLE (SCM_ARG1, type);
layout = SCM_VTABLE_LAYOUT (type);
if (scm_i_symbol_length (layout) / 2 < n)
scm_out_of_range (FUNC_NAME, scm_from_size_t (n));
for (i = 0; i < n; i++)
if (scm_i_symbol_ref (layout, i * 2) != 'u')
scm_wrong_type_arg_msg (FUNC_NAME, 0, layout, "'u' field");
obj = scm_c_make_structv (type, 0, 0, NULL);
for (i = 0; i < n; i++)
SCM_STRUCT_DATA_SET (obj, i, vals[i]);
return obj;
}
#undef FUNC_NAME
scm_t_bits
scm_foreign_object_ref (SCM obj, size_t n)
#define FUNC_NAME "foreign-object-ref"
{
SCM layout;
SCM_VALIDATE_STRUCT (SCM_ARG1, obj);
layout = SCM_STRUCT_LAYOUT (obj);
if (scm_i_symbol_length (layout) / 2 < n)
scm_out_of_range (FUNC_NAME, scm_from_size_t (n));
if (scm_i_symbol_ref (layout, n * 2) != 'u')
scm_wrong_type_arg_msg (FUNC_NAME, 0, layout, "'u' field");
return SCM_STRUCT_DATA_REF (obj, n);
}
#undef FUNC_NAME
void
scm_foreign_object_set_x (SCM obj, size_t n, scm_t_bits val)
#define FUNC_NAME "foreign-object-set!"
{
SCM layout;
SCM_VALIDATE_STRUCT (SCM_ARG1, obj);
layout = SCM_STRUCT_LAYOUT (obj);
if (scm_i_symbol_length (layout) / 2 < n)
scm_out_of_range (FUNC_NAME, scm_from_size_t (n));
if (scm_i_symbol_ref (layout, n * 2) != 'u')
scm_wrong_type_arg_msg (FUNC_NAME, 0, layout, "'u' field");
SCM_STRUCT_DATA_SET (obj, n, val);
}
#undef FUNC_NAME
static void
invoke_finalizer (void *obj, void *data)
{
scm_call_1 (PTR2SCM (data), PTR2SCM (obj));
}
static SCM
sys_add_finalizer_x (SCM obj, SCM finalizer)
#define FUNC_NAME "%add-finalizer!"
{
SCM_VALIDATE_PROC (SCM_ARG2, finalizer);
scm_i_add_finalizer (SCM2PTR (obj), invoke_finalizer, SCM2PTR (finalizer));
return SCM_UNSPECIFIED;
}
#undef FUNC_NAME
static void
scm_init_foreign_object (void)
{
scm_c_define_gsubr ("%add-finalizer!", 2, 0, 0,
(scm_t_subr) sys_add_finalizer_x);
}
void
scm_register_foreign_object (void)
{
scm_c_register_extension ("libguile-" SCM_EFFECTIVE_VERSION,
"scm_init_foreign_object",
(scm_t_extension_init_func)scm_init_foreign_object,
NULL);
}
